Argument: The War on Drugs has caused the price of many illicit drugs to increase

Supporting evidence
In 2006, the Office of National Drug Control Policy (ONDCP) and the State Department said that prices of cocaine in America had risen, making the case that this demonstrated the success of the strategy to eradicate cocaine in Columbia in. The ONDCP said in its 2006 National Drug Control Strategy that "Overseas counterdrug efforts have slowly constricted the pipeline that brings cocaine to the United States".[1]
